Fine Print: Boquillas, Coahuila, 1979 Limited Edition Fine Prints inviting viewers to immerse themselvesWebb began his career as a photographer in the 1970s, making pictures of the American social landscape in the streets of New England and New York, working exclusively in black and white. In the preface to The Suffering of Light, he describes having reached a kind of dead end in photography, as well as an eagerness to explore new territories.
